    For the past 30 years Claire Newell spends at least an hour each morning researching travel news stories and has appeared on Global TV BC (6 times/week), CKNW Radio (4 times/week), and is a regular guest on Global TV’s national ‘The Morning Show’. She’s traveled to 73 countries (and counting!) sharing her travel stories & tips to many. Claire has been a guest on BC’s Today Show, Fox & Friends, CNN, and other national programs. She has written articles for various print and online publications, as well as authoring her own best-selling book, Travel Best Bets - An. Insider’s Guide to Taking Your Best Trips, Ever.

  • Ariane Henry joins us from Ubud, Bali and is a luxury travel advisor and Virtuoso Member focusing on both bespoke experiential travel and cruises through her company Wanderlust Journey. While she travels the world and curates exceptional travel experiences for her clients; she was also named as one of CondĂ© Nast Traveler’s Top Travel Specialists for 2021, 2022 and 2023. She has also been featured in both CondĂ© Nast Traveler and Lonely Planet magazines as well as launched a successful YouTube channel in 2021 which has been attracting new, qualified clients to her growing business.

  • Ashley joins us from Baltimore, Maryland where we dive into the 10 year journey she’s been on to create high quality, transformative experiences for those looking to travel in an impactful way. After leaving her corporate job at a Fortune 50 company, Ashley followed her passion to start a charity called Jelani Gives - to help open up the world to youth that are less fortunate to see it.

    From there Jelani Travel was formed and now celebrates it’s 10 year anniversary creating curated experiences for Black travelers, reimagining Africa and fostering cultural understanding.

    The company has planned over 600 travel experiences, visited 108 countries, explored 6 continents and explored 35 states! Ashley has spoken and worked with Brands such as Google, Mailchimp, Lyft & Uber about unique travel experiences for their workforce. Jelani Travel also focuses on custom group trips for anyone looking to explore a new destination intimately.

  • From the Corporate world with degrees in Law & History; Aukje ceased to be inspired by the industry she was in and discovered a true passion for adventure when cycling from Tanzania to the Netherlands. Hear her incredible story of resiliency while pushing through this 11 month journey that had her making a career change once home.

    ​Knowing that tourism is her passion she moved into the role of Director of the Respect the Mountains Foundation which brought the message of ecotourism and live events to the European Sustainable Mountain Tourism market. Then in 2018 Aukje started working for Rewilding Europe where she managed the in-house travel company and was in charge of Wildlife Tourism development & training in the different rewilding areas.

    She co-created the rewilding tourism training program in 2020, which trained over 200 travel & tourism professionals. In 2023, Aukje poured her heart and soul in yet another challenge: starting MOYO Training Foundation and making a Nature Positive impact on the travel, tourism & training industry.

  • Sarah Coote is a woman who has followed her love of the ocean and passion for travel to fully immerse herself in travel in every career she’s had. She’s currently working and living on Christmas Island, an incredible island located 350km south of Indonesia.

    If you haven’t heard of Christmas Island, well just remember that every day is a gift when waking up on Christmas Island. From giant rubber crabs migrating, to eco lodges or bird watching the frigatebird to swimming with humpback whales with what seems to be a never ending sunset on the horizon - the more layers you discover of Christmas Island, the more you will want to go back every year.

    Sarah has toured guests from her first job as a dolphin instructor to living abroad most of her life and bringing her family with spouse and 4 children along for the ride! With over 18 years of experience in tourism and over 15 years experience in business, project management, tourism & destination marketing, photography and cinematography she has gotten to promote destinations on land and underwater around the globe.   • Julie-Ann Chapman is a reminder that when you put your mind to something you can accomplish it - with hard work, discipline and a whole lot of fun. From a professional snowboarder in 2004 to a complete snowmobile rookie, Julie-Ann, has learned what it takes from the ground up to start a business in tourism and dominated in it! She is sponsored by Polaris & Klim, has been published in over 20 snowmobile magazines and been awarded from the House of Commons in Canada - BC Snowmobile Federation Snowmobiler of the Year. She has ventured through the backcountry and started She Shreds snowmobile clinics for women back when there weren’t many women in the industry at all. She Shreds now offers not only clinics, but also avalanche courses, occupational training (for Search & Rescue, RCMP, forestry employees etc.), snowmobile rentals and guided adventures. Based on out of Nelson & Pemberton BC she has also travelled all over BC to teach - Revelstoke, Golden, Valemount and out to Quebec and the USA.
